Output 09c49865a8da548a642ec57f54a97e961da9a898525d095e0a166168b9803458:3

value
29742792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6eb9076c3c003fa42bb2a23e79a1c1a0a518960 OP_EQUAL
address
3KpoupbsQLGgxGcKepHZrmcpDyFLwYymkk
transaction
09c49865a8da548a642ec57f54a97e961da9a898525d095e0a166168b9803458
spent
true